Sadio Mane 100th Liverpool goal shattered the English Premier League (EPL) record on Saturday as the Senegalese became the first player to score in the nine consecutive top-flight matches against the same opponent.
Liverpool forward`s scoring run against Crystal Palace started back in August 2017. It moved Mane one ahead of Robin van Persie, who had found the net in eight PL matches in a row against Stoke City.
